I have the same problem here. I have breadboarded an EP1C3T100 the best I could, with the 3.3V, 1.5V and ground going to what I believe are the right places based on the Altera data sheet (I will post a schematic later), an oscillator, no configuration device at the moment, just the config pins set to fixed levels so that the chip *should* be idle (not trying to configure itself).
The chip is drawing over 100mA on the 1.5V and that seems excessive. The Altera FAE said it should be more like 30mA.
I need help in the form of a minimum schematic to bring the chip us with the JTAG and an LED (blinky).
Ant recommendation appreciated. I will try to draw a clean schematic of what I have later today and post it.
